Searched refs:sock_arp (Results 1 - 2 of 2) sorted by relevance
/kernel/linux/linux-6.6/samples/bpf/ |
H A D | xdp_router_ipv4_user.c | 455 int sock, sock_arp, nll; in monitor_routes_thread() local 477 sock_arp = socket(AF_NETLINK, SOCK_RAW, NETLINK_ROUTE); in monitor_routes_thread() 478 if (sock_arp < 0) { in monitor_routes_thread() 484 fcntl(sock_arp, F_SETFL, O_NONBLOCK); in monitor_routes_thread() 488 if (bind(sock_arp, (struct sockaddr *)&la, sizeof(la)) < 0) { in monitor_routes_thread() 493 fds_arp.fd = sock_arp; in monitor_routes_thread() 523 nll = recv_msg(la, sock_arp); in monitor_routes_thread() 538 close(sock_arp); in monitor_routes_thread()
|
/kernel/linux/linux-5.10/samples/bpf/ |
H A D | xdp_router_ipv4_user.c | 28 int sock, sock_arp, flags = XDP_FLAGS_UPDATE_IF_NOEXIST; variable 67 close(sock_arp); in close_and_exit() 547 sock_arp = socket(AF_NETLINK, SOCK_RAW, NETLINK_ROUTE); in monitor_route() 548 if (sock_arp < 0) { in monitor_route() 553 fcntl(sock_arp, F_SETFL, O_NONBLOCK); in monitor_route() 557 if (bind(sock_arp, (struct sockaddr *)&la, sizeof(la)) < 0) { in monitor_route() 562 fds_arp.fd = sock_arp; in monitor_route() 599 nll = recv_msg(la, sock_arp); in monitor_route()
|
Completed in 2 milliseconds